US on Pakistan nuclear concerns

President Obama's national security adviser, General James Jones, has spoken about US relations with Pakistan and the safety of its nuclear arsenal amid concern about the increased threat posed by the Taleban.

The Pakistani President, Asif Ali Zardari is due to visit Washington this week.

Speaking to the BBC's Justin Webb, Mr Jones said the US would do everything it could, in conjunction with its partners, to prevent nuclear weapons falling into the hands of the Taleban.
